What is Position Trading?

In its simplest form, position trading is a long-term strategy that focuses on capturing large market moves. Unlike day trading or swing trading, which can involve multiple trades within a single day or week, position traders hold onto their trades for weeks, months, or even years. The goal? To profit from substantial price movements in the market.

Position traders typically use fundamental analysis to identify trends and make informed decisions about when to enter and exit trades. They're not concerned with short-term price fluctuations; instead, they're looking for sustained movements in the market that can lead to significant profits.

Why Choose Position Trading?

Position trading has several advantages that make it an attractive choice for many traders. Here are a few reasons why you might want to consider giving it a try:

Long-Term Perspective

One of the biggest benefits of position trading is the long-term perspective it offers. By focusing on sustained trends, you can avoid the noise and volatility of the short-term market. This can lead to less stress and more consistent profits over time.

Less Time Commitment

Since position trades can last for months or even years, this strategy requires far less time commitment than day or swing trading. As a position trader, you'll have more time to focus on other aspects of your life, like family, friends, or even other hobbies.

Potential for Large Profits

Because position trades are held for extended periods, they have the potential to generate significant profits. Even a small price movement in the market can result in a substantial gain when you're holding a position for months on end.

Getting Started with Position Trading

Now that you understand the basics of position trading, let's talk about how to get started. Here are some key steps to help you on your way:

Choose Your Markets

The first step in position trading is to decide which markets you want to focus on. This could be anything from stocks and forex to commodities or cryptocurrencies. The key is to choose markets that you're familiar with and that align with your risk tolerance.

Once you've chosen your markets, it's time to start identifying trends. As a position trader, you're looking for sustained movements in the market, so focus on long-term charts (like daily or weekly) and look for clear trends.

Use Fundamental Analysis

Position traders rely heavily on fundamental analysis to make informed decisions about when to enter and exit trades. This involves looking at a wide range of factors, from economic indicators to company earnings reports, to get a complete picture of the market.

Set Your Entry and Exit Points

Before you enter a trade, you need to have a clear plan for both your entry and exit points. This will help you stay disciplined and avoid making emotional decisions based on short-term price movements.

Manage Your Risk

Like any form of trading, position trading carries risk. To protect your portfolio, it's essential to use stop-loss orders to limit your potential losses. You should also diversify your trades to spread risk across multiple markets.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Even the most experienced traders can fall into traps when it comes to position trading. Here are some common mistakes to avoid:

Chasing the Market

It can be tempting to jump into a trade once you see a significant price movement, but this is a surefire way to lose money. Instead, focus on identifying trends early and entering trades at the beginning of a sustained movement.

Ignoring Your Stop-Loss

Setting a stop-loss order is crucial, but it's no use if you don't stick to it. Don't let emotions or greed cloud your judgment; if the market moves against you, be prepared to cut your losses and move on.

Overtrading

Just because you're a position trader doesn't mean you should be in the market at all times. Be patient, and only enter trades when you have a clear signal and a well-thought-out plan.
